Output 58a86dabf56ac5e3a285685eefaac50ebed9c64d260fa865660153ba27aa9174:0

value
1285284
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a832094ac032bed1fd63f0e846d5e1c30333034b OP_EQUALVERIFY OP_CHECKSIG
address
1GLLTp14sW34BH6J6xjJANzoqEUxeMXJYV
transaction
58a86dabf56ac5e3a285685eefaac50ebed9c64d260fa865660153ba27aa9174
spent
true